Sober Island

Sober Island is a community within Halifax, Nova Scotia, which is situated in the Greater Halifax metropolitan area.

Transportation

The car is usually the preferred means of transportation in Sober Island. Parking is generally easy. Traveling by foot is not very feasible for property owners in this part of the municipality as running common errands is practically impossible without a vehicle. Getting around by bicycle is also difficult in this area as the terrain is not very flat, and Sober Island is home to quite poor cycling infrastructure.

Services

This community does not have any high schools or primary schools. In terms of eating, property owners in this part of the municipality almost always have to use a car to do grocery shopping.

Character

The character of Sober Island is exemplified by its slower-paced ambience. Sober Island is especially quiet overall, as there tend to be low levels of noise from traffic. Parks aren't well-situated, making it very difficult to get to them.

Housing

Around 90% of the population of this community own their home whereas the rest are renters. The housing stock of this area is composed predominantly of single detached homes and townhouses. Around 30% of properties in this part of the municipality were constructed between 1960 and 1980, while the majority of the remaining buildings were constructed pre-1960 and in the 1980s. This community offers mainly four or more bedroom and three bedroom homes.
